LinuxCNC: an open source CNC machine controller. It can drive milling machines, lathes, 3d printers, laser cutters, plasma cutters, robot arms, hexapods, and more.

LinuxCNC (the Enhanced Machine Control) features and specs

  • Open Source
    LinuxCNC is open-source, allowing users to access and modify the source code. This encourages community collaboration and enables users to tailor the software to their specific needs.
  • Cost-Effective
    Being open-source, LinuxCNC is free to use, which reduces the cost for individuals and organizations looking to implement CNC control systems.
  • Flexibility and Customization
    LinuxCNC offers a high degree of flexibility allowing users to design custom configurations and write personalized scripts for their machine operations.
  • Large Community Support
    With a dedicated user base, LinuxCNC has a wealth of forums and community-driven support which can be incredibly helpful for troubleshooting and exchanging best practices.
  • Real-Time Performance
    Utilizes real-time kernel extensions that provide precise control over machine operations, a necessity for CNC applications requiring high precision.

Possible disadvantages of LinuxCNC (the Enhanced Machine Control)

  • Steep Learning Curve
    LinuxCNC can be challenging to learn, especially for beginners unfamiliar with Linux operating systems or CNC machinery concepts.
  • Limited Commercial Support
    Being an open-source project, it lacks formal customer support which can be a disadvantage for commercial enterprises needing professional service.
  • Compatibility Issues
    Some hardware compatibility issues may arise, particularly with newer or less common equipment, requiring additional troubleshooting or drivers.
  • Complex Setup
    The installation and configuration process can be complex, often involving custom setups and detailed understanding of both hardware and software components.
  • Less Intuitive Interface
    Compared to some commercial CNC software options, the graphical interface of LinuxCNC may feel dated or less intuitive to some users.

  • Real-time Linux is officially part of the kernel
    The only time I have used real-time linux was for CNC control through linuxcnc (formerly emc2). https://linuxcnc.org/ It works great, and with a bit of tuning and the right hardware it could achieve ~1us worse cast jitter numbers (tested by setting a 1ms timer and measuring how long it actually takes using the linuxcnc internal tooling).   • Can anybody recommend a good CNC conversion kit?
    For a hobby machine, DIY might be the way to go. I did my sharp knee mill over several years. Ball screws from Rockford ball screws, were not cheap, but work well. Servo motors and gecko motor controllers from automationtechnologiesinc.com. Scales for feed back from dropros. Controller card from mesanet.com. All controlled with linuxcnc.org and a usb controller from vistacnc.com. Milled motor mounts for the... Source: over 3 years ago
